大数跨境

OpenClaw(龙虾)在Debian 11怎么调用API命令示例

2026-03-19 0
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一个开源的、面向跨境电商数据采集与自动化任务调度的命令行工具,非商业SaaS产品,常被技术型卖家或运营团队用于批量抓取平台商品页、监控价格/库存变化或对接内部ERP。其名称‘龙虾’为项目代号,与生物或海鲜无关;‘OpenClaw’强调开源(Open)与抓取能力(Claw)。Debian 11(代号bullseye)是其主流支持的操作系统环境之一。

 

要点速读(TL;DR)

  • OpenClaw 是开源CLI工具,非官方平台API,不提供账号托管、合规授权或数据清洗服务
  • 在Debian 11上需手动编译或通过Cargo安装,依赖Rust 1.65+、libssl-dev等系统组件;
  • 调用API命令本质是发送HTTP请求(如curl或内置fetch模块),需自行构造User-Agent、Headers、Cookies及反爬绕过逻辑;
  • 无中心化服务端,所有API交互由本地脚本发起,不经过第三方中转,数据不出本地服务器。

它能解决哪些问题

  • 场景痛点:人工监控100+竞品链接价格变动耗时低效 → 对应价值:用OpenClaw编写定时任务,自动GET页面并解析price字段,输出CSV供BI分析;
  • 场景痛点:ERP系统缺实时库存接口(如速卖通部分类目未开放官方API)→ 对应价值:用OpenClaw模拟浏览器行为抓取前端展示库存,经正则提取后写入本地数据库;
  • 场景痛点:多平台比价需重复登录、切换设备指纹 → 对应价值:通过OpenClaw配置多Profile(含代理IP、TLS指纹、Cookie池),实现跨站点并发采集。

怎么用/怎么开通/怎么选择

OpenClaw无“开通”流程(非SaaS服务),属自部署工具。在Debian 11上的标准使用路径如下:

  1. 确认系统环境:执行 lsb_release -a 确认为Debian 11;运行 uname -m 验证架构(推荐x86_64);
  2. 安装Rust工具链:执行 curl --proto '=https' --tlsv1.2 -sSf https://sh.rustup.rs | sh,并source ~/.cargo/env;
  3. 安装系统依赖:运行 sudo apt update && sudo apt install -y build-essential libssl-dev pkg-config curl
  4. 获取OpenClaw源码:从GitHub官方仓库(github.com/openclaw/openclaw)克隆,或用 cargo install --git https://github.com/openclaw/openclaw
  5. 编写配置文件:创建 config.yaml,定义target_url、selectors(如price: "span#priceblock_ourprice")、delay、user_agent等;
  6. 执行采集命令:运行 openclaw run --config config.yaml --output results.json,结果默认输出为JSON格式。

费用/成本通常受哪些因素影响

  • 是否需自建代理IP池(影响带宽与IP采购成本);
  • 是否启用Headless Chrome模式(增加内存/CPU占用,影响VPS配置成本);
  • 采集频率与并发数(高频请求易触发目标站风控,需配套验证码识别方案,推高开发维护成本);
  • 是否需定制解析逻辑(如JS渲染页需集成WebDriver,延长开发周期);
  • 团队是否具备Rust/Shell/HTTP协议基础(影响内部落地效率,间接构成人力成本)。

为了拿到准确部署与维护成本,你通常需要准备:目标站点URL结构、日均请求数量、页面渲染复杂度(静态HTML or SPA)、现有服务器配置(CPU/内存/带宽)、是否已有代理与Cookie管理机制。

常见坑与避坑清单

  • 坑1:直接在root用户下运行OpenClaw导致权限冲突 → 避坑:新建普通用户(如sudo adduser clawuser),全程以该用户操作;
  • 坑2:忽略Debian 11默认禁用SSLv3及弱加密套件,导致部分老站点HTTPS握手失败 → 避坑:编译前设置 RUSTFLAGS="-C link-args=-lssl -lcrypto" 并验证OpenSSL版本≥1.1.1;
  • 坑3:用默认User-Agent直连Amazon/eBay等平台,100%返回403 → 避坑:在config.yaml中强制指定主流浏览器UA,并启用--rotate-ua参数;
  • 坑4:未处理JavaScript重定向或动态token(如AliExpress的_csrf)→ 避坑:优先选用OpenClaw的playwright插件模式(需额外安装Chromium),而非纯HTTP模式。

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w是MIT协议开源项目,代码完全公开可审计,无后门或数据回传机制。但其用途受目标网站robots.txt及服务条款约束——例如未经许可抓取Amazon商品详情页可能违反其Acceptable Use Policy。合规性取决于使用者自身场景:用于个人竞品调研(非商用、低频、带合理延时)风险较低;用于大规模商用数据聚合或替代官方API,需法务评估。

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

适合具备Linux运维基础、有自主开发能力的中大型跨境团队,尤其适用于:① 多平台比价(Amazon US/DE/JP、Shopee MY/TW、Lazada TH);② 小众平台(如Temu早期未开放API时)的数据探查;③ 非标类目(汽配、工业品)的参数抓取。不推荐新手或无技术资源的个体卖家直接使用。

O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?

无需开通、注册或购买。它是免费开源工具,无账号体系。接入只需:Debian 11服务器访问权限、sudo权限(首次安装依赖)、Git/Cargo网络可达(需能访问crates.io及GitHub)。无需提交营业执照、店铺资质或平台授权文件。

结尾

OpenClaw(龙虾)是技术型卖家的轻量级数据工具,不是开箱即用的SaaS——能力上限取决于你的工程投入。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业